Hi Patty-

I'm a pediatrician, type I diabetic for 10 years, and my endocrinologist
just tested me for celiac a few months ago and I have the antibodies.  I
have started GF even though I haven't yet had my biopsy, and I also have
noted MORE GI symptoms since.  I have my first GI appointment on Thursday
and I will certainly ask them.  Everyone says "oh now you're just looking
for symptoms" but I didn't have them before.   As a doc, I wonder if it is
because the villi are regrowing, and that's what hurts?  who knows.  Anyway,
let's be in touch-

good luck with your son, I'm on a pump and love it.  I show it to all my
diabetic patients.

> My son was dx with Type 1 diabetes in Sept of this year.  While we were at
> the hospital, the Dr. decided to do a blood test for celiac as well, the
> results were positive enought to do the biopsy and yes he has it.  He had
> NO previous symptoms at all.  He has been gluten free now for almost 3
> months and now he has the symptoms.  Stomache aches, can't go to school,
> sick after he eats.  Any ideas on what is causing this?  I'm guessing he's
> getting cross contaminated somehow and is very sensitive.  I'm very
> frustrated because he was feeling much better before we took him off the
> gluten.
